$NetBSD: patch-be,v 1.1.1.1 2002/01/21 11:56:18 pooka Exp $

--- src/files.c.orig	Sun Jun 24 18:57:16 2001
+++ src/files.c
@@ -769,7 +769,7 @@
 	}
 	(void) signal(SIGINT, SIG_IGN);
 	(void) signal(SIGQUIT, SIG_IGN);
-	(void) wait((int *)&i);
+	(void) waitpid(f, (int *)&i, 0);
 	(void) signal(SIGINT, (SIG_RET_TYPE) done1);
 # ifdef WIZARD
 	if (wizard) (void) signal(SIGQUIT, SIG_DFL);
